Hiya folks, you only have to read the paper or look in the shops to notice that TV’s have never been so cheap. My query is before I go out and buy one is what will happen in a year or so time when analogue is turned off. Will we all have to go out and buy Freeveiw or sky or will these not be compatible. Basically what I’m asking are we all getting good deals or are the shops just selling them cheap because they’ll be no good shortly once the turnoff has happened.
If the Freeview boxes are the answer then should we be buying them now before prices go sky high, and will we need one for each TV in the house?
